February 1, 2010 – Plaintiff was a passenger in the right rear seat of a vehicle that failed to yield the right of way and was struck on the right side. She suffered a broken left wrist, facial lacerations and a brain injury that resolved to the point that she is doing above-average work in college. However, about 12 months after the crash, she developed a post-traumatic involuntary muscle disorder or tic syndrome similar to Tourette syndrome. Plaintiff incurred $197,000 in past and future medical expenses.
